About Vinnytsia
The city is particularly famous for its stunning fountains and the picturesque Southern Bug River. While it may not be as touristy as other Ukrainian cities, Vinnytsia offers a unique glimpse into local life and traditions.

History
Vinnytsia has a rich history dating back to the 14th century, originally founded as a fortress. Over the centuries, it has been influenced by various cultures, including Polish and Russian, which shaped its unique character.
The city played a significant role during World War II and has since rebuilt itself into a vibrant urban center. Today, Vinnytsia is known for its cultural heritage and as a hub for education and industry in Ukraine.
